Template:Redirect Template:More images Template:Infobox item Host armor trim is a type of smithing template used in smithing tables to add a trim to Minecraft:armor. It is consumed when used, but can be duplicated using an existing template, Minecraft:terracotta, and Minecraft:diamonds.

Obtaining

This item is found in trail ruins. Once obtained, it can be duplicated using the crafting recipe below.

Generated loot

This item can only be extracted from suspicious gravel using a Minecraft:brush.

Usage

It is an ingredient in its own recipe, making it possible to craft copies after the initial item is found.
